			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>You have just spent a huge amount of time and money planning every detail of your wedding celebration. You will want to recall every memory of this occasion.&nbsp; Knowing how to preserve special memories of your wedding day will keep this day fresh forever, allowing you to revisit it with family and friends.</p>
<p>
If you have chosen a popular time to have the wedding like Valentine&#8217;s Day or in June, you will need to hire a photographer months in advance.&nbsp; Start interviewing early, because this person will follow you around all day, recording your preparations, wedding, and reception, and it won&#8217;t be a good experience for you if you don&#8217;t like and trust him.</p>
<p>
Inform him of everything you want done; who is in what group shot, whether you want a video of the ceremony, if you want candid shots throughout, and what kind of packages you expect to purchase.&nbsp; Ask questions!&nbsp; You need to know detailed costs of what is included.</p>
<p>
You might want a DVD, a slide presentation, a collage of candid shots, your formal sitting album and a separate album of the unposed shots. How many hours is he willing to spend? Will he be working alone or have more than one camera covering the event?&nbsp; Can he do a photo montage that follows the history of your relationship?&nbsp; Learn the price of every single extra.</p>
<p>
To cut costs you might want to follow the trendy method of placing disposable cameras on every table and collect your candid shots compliments of the guests!&nbsp; If you hate the idea of those cameras marring the beauty of your table setting, set your bridesmaids to making little paper covers to slip them into!</p>
<p>
If you are saving the wedding gown, it should be dry cleaned professionally as soon as possible after the wedding, so that any stains can be safely removed.&nbsp; Vacuum sealing the dress in plastic has been found to harm delicate fabrics.&nbsp; It is better to fold it loosely, wrap it in acid free tissue paper, and then pack it away in an archival box. The veil can be stored in the same box, but wrap it separately.</p>
<p>
Several methods can be used on the bridal bouquet, depending on how long you wish to preserve it, how you want to store it, and how much effort and money you want to invest in the process.&nbsp; Easiest for you is to have a service coat the flower arrangement in its original form and then store it in an air-tight shadowbox.&nbsp; This must be done within a day of the wedding before it wilts.</p>
<p>
You can dry the bouquet by hanging it upside down in a dark place. This will not last forever. Sometimes it is enough to simply press a few flowers from your bouquet between wax paper and a couple of large books.&nbsp; Then they can be arranged in a scrapbook&#8230;another good thing to keep to preserve special memories of your wedding day. Keep all those important reminders of your day in a scrap book &ndash; order of service, the invitation, perhaps a copy of the speeches or a piece of material from the bridesmaids dress.</p>
<p>
By taking a little time to preserve these moments, you&rsquo;ll ensure that memories of your special day will last a lifetime.<br />

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>When planning to decorate the church and reception area, consider that many places are already decorated during the winter season. This can drastically cut down on decorating costs for you. Use theirs or add to it. Flower garlands make beautiful swags for doorways, windows, railings, and balconies. A snow theme is perfect for winter weddings. Decorate with icicle lights and snowflakes and even hire a snow-making machine! Use diamonds, pearls, rubies, and other sparkle items for glamour effect. Thread the room with tulle material intertwined with icicle lights for a softer mood. White birch branches add a dramatic element. Drape icicle lights around the branches, and put the twig bouquet in huge vases. You can also hang crystal beads from the branches for shine.</p>
<p>Keep up your winter theme with a reception room housing a big fireplace. Play winter music, such as &ldquo;Winter Wonderland&rdquo; or &ldquo;The Gift.&rdquo; Serve hot chocolate or eggnog as guests walk into the reception area, and give them roasted chestnuts in paper bags. Pick foods to serve which have warm winter memories for you. This will add a special touch to the food line.</p>
<p>For a fun entrance into the reception room, have a bouquet of mistletoe hanging over the entryway. On tables, place wreaths with candles in the middle of them or decorate with holly and candles. Find candle holders and wine glasses the same as your main wedding color and use them on the tables. Place red cranberries in bowls of water with floating tea candles or be more playful and place gingerbread houses around the room. A seasonal ice sculpture is stunning on the main table.</p>
<p>Decorate the layers and top of your cake with your wedding flowers. White, frosted pinecones are a wintery addition, as well. As an alternative to a cake, serve cupcakes on a tiered cake stand. On the top tier, have a small cake so you can cut it as a couple. Top with a sugar sculpture.</p>
<p>For guest favors, hand out cookie cutters with a recipe attached with your names, wedding date, and &ldquo;truly cut out for each other.&rdquo; Or place a sticker with your names and wedding date on the bottoms of gold- or silver-wrapped Hershey kisses. Wrap white bon bons in cellophane and tie with wedding color ribbons.&nbsp; </p>
<p>Ready to leave your magical event? Ride away in a horse-drawn sleigh. Or a white stretch limousine never goes out of style. Have your guests throw white rose petals or, for an evening wedding, wave sparklers.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>What does winter conjure up for you? Hot chocolate, a roaring fire, snow? Winter time lends magic to the air! Why not turn your romantic ideas of winter into the perfect, enchanting winter wedding for you?</p>
<p>Choosing the right colors makes the whole wedding come together. Traditional colors are reds and greens combined with ivory and gold. Mix and match them together for your favorite effect, such as red/white with highlights of green or gold. For a more modern and winter wonderland look, use silver and white, or silver and royal or light blue. Silver and white are striking combinations, as well.<br />
&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; <br />
Winter weddings dresses are exceptions to the popular strapless dresses. Opt for warmer, luxurious dresses. Look for a high-low hem (slightly shorter in front and long in the back). Add faux fur added to the hem, sleeves, and neckline. Or add a fur wrap for an elegant (and warm!) look. Long sleeves are best, while bell sleeves are a romantic alternative. Do not be afraid to add a splash of color to your dress, such as a ribbon around your waist or wearing a richly colored cape. If you want to make a statement, wear a red, velvet dress. For a snowy effect, add beads and sequins onto your dress. </p>
<p>The perfect accessory for your dress is long, silk gloves or even short, fur-trimmed gloves. Not only do they look elegant, they help to keep you warm! Or carry a fur muff instead of a bouquet. If you want a bouquet, carry a crystal one, especially for a snow wedding. </p>
<p>Your bridesmaids&rsquo; dresses should be long. Add a shrug or jacket to strapless styles. Their dress colors depend on your theme colors. Greens and reds are striking with gold accent ribbons. Light or navy blues are complimented with silver. Instead of flowers, have them carry candles, or if you are carrying a muff, they could carry one, too. </p>
<p>Style hair with flowers from your bouquet. Use holly, ivy, or baby&rsquo;s breath and tiny berries to add a festivity or delicacy. A sparkly tiara works with silver colors. Do you have long hair? For a soft look, leave your hair down in loose curls.</p>
<p>The groom can wear a cummerbund matching the bridesmaids&rsquo; dresses. Or, if you are wearing a colored wrap, match the cummerbund with your wrap. If the groom and groomsmen wear vests, match them to the bridesmaids&rsquo; dress colors. A white tuxedo looks striking for winter occasions, especially with the blue/silver colors. </p>
<p>Red roses, while beautiful, are not the only perfect wedding flowers to choose. More inexpensively, use holly and berries. These work well together with red and green colors. Ivy is a graceful addition. Add pinecones to bouquets, along with red and ivory poinsettias. Baby&rsquo;s breath adds a spray of snowy white. </p>

<p>Outdoor weddings are enormously popular in the summertime. Few of us can escape the months of June, July, and August without receiving at least one invitation to an outdoor nuptial ceremony. For those planning and coordinating these events, decorating becomes a special challenge. The great outdoors isn&#8217;t a clearly defined space like a church or reception hall. Where do you begin? In this article, we&#8217;ll cover some of the basics that you&#8217;ll need to know for decorating an outdoor wedding of your dreams.</p>
<p>In an outdoor wedding ceremony, there are three primary areas of decorating that need to be addressed: the entrance, the seating area, and the altar. By defining each of these areas with unique and meaningful decorations, you will help set the tone of your wedding and a theme, if so desired. We&#8217;ll address each of these areas separately.</p>
<p><strong>The Entrance: </strong></p>
<p>First impressions are everything. When your guests arrive, you want them to feel excited about the special occasion they are about to witness. This can easily be accomplished by creating a unique pathway to the wedding site. The beginning of the pathway should be marked and recognizable. Consider placing garden fountains on either side of the path or an arbor draped in flowers for your guests to walk through. Large urns of flowers can be used and also placed along the path to lead the way. If you are having an evening wedding, consider including landscaping lights to outline the pathway and provide lighting.</p>
<p><strong>The Seating Area: </strong></p>
<p>Seating is always a challenge at an outdoor wedding. You&#8217;ll likely have to rent chairs for your guests to sit on. You&#8217;ll want your guests to feel like they are part of an intimate setting, so be considerate of how the chairs are arranged. Make sure that each person has the best possible vantage point of the bride and groom. When decorating the chairs, consider using strings of flowers and ribbons along the backs of the last row of chairs to add an elegant touch to the seating area. If your guests are entering and exiting from a center isle, you might consider draping the outsides of the rows with flowers and ribbons, as well. Consider placing urns of flowers or even free standing patio trellises along the outside of the chair rows. This can add a burst of color, as well as some privacy for your ceremony.</p>
<p><strong>The Altar: </strong></p>
<p>The altar is arguably the most important part of decorating in a wedding ceremony. After all, the bride and groom should be the center of the day. It is important that your guests have the ability to see and hear you during the ceremony. If it will be a large outdoor gathering with more than 50 people, you may want to use a sound system so guests in back can hear you.</p>
<p>If the ground is relatively flat, you might also want to elevate the bride, groom, and officiant. This can easily be accomplished with a sturdy platform to stand on, and the platform can be decorated as desired with flowers, bows, and cloth. You may also want to create a special backdrop or surround for your vows. An overhead structure such as a wedding arbor or garden pergola can be a great option for this. Arbors and pergolas can easily be purchased as ready to assemble kits, and they come in a variety of colors, sizes, and configurations. After the ceremony is over, the garden structure can then be gifted to the happy couple for their new home.</p>
<p>Planning any wedding is a lot of work, but decorating an outdoor wedding doesn&#8217;t have to be. By paying attention to the three most important areas, the entrance, seating area, and altar, you will ensure that the event is beautifully decorated and your guests are dazzled on your special day.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>This isn&#8217;t your Aunt Mabel&#8217;s wedding! You&#8217;ve got attitude and it&#8217;s your day to say it! colour your wedding!  Vibrant, exciting? You don&#8217;t dress in pale colour and you don&#8217;t have to dress your wedding that way either!</p>
<p>Here&#8217;s a list of colours and their meanings in our society:</p>
<p><em>WHITE:</em> Brides have been dressing in white since 1840, when Queen Victoria married in a white, opulent gown. Before that, brides wore any colour but black. White symbolizes purity, the innocence of childhood. In the Christian liturgy, it symbolizes the brightness of the day.</p>
<p><em>GOLD:</em> In Christian liturgy, gold, like white, symbolizes the brightness of the day. In our culture, it often symbolizes riches. As a trim or accessory to earth tones (brown, green, orange) it may give vibrancy and glow. It also works well with bright and full colours such as burgundy, deep green.</p>
<p><em>BLACK:</em> The traditional colour of mourning, but recently it has become the colour of sophistication. For a svelte wedding, it is perfectly acceptable to dress your bridesmaids in black, perhaps with white accessories and trim. It also can make a maturing accent with a bright or light main colour.</p>
<p><em>PURPLE/VIOLET:</em> Way back to early Egypt, purple has represented royalty. During the Renaissance, purple, deep red and black were royal colours and, at time, ordinary people could be arrested for using those special colours. But you can use them! Purple, in Christian liturgy, symbolizes the sovereignty of Christ and repentance of sin. In China, though, purple is the colour of mourning.</p>
<p><em>RED:</em> Usually a symbol of blood and fire, it is a conflicted colour: One side expresses war and violence, but the other side expresses love, warmth and compassion. Our brides don&#8217;t usually wear red, but in China it is the traditional colour for a wedding dress and symbolizes good luck. It is traditional in India, also. Consider using red, if you love it, at your wedding.</p>
<p><em>GREEN:</em> Symbol of growth. Combines the spiritual aspect of blue and the emotional vibrancy of yellow. It combines beautifully with other earth tones as well as gold tones. In China is represents the Yin, the passive and receptive principle.</p>
<p><em>BLUE:</em> colour of the sky, this colour is associated with spirituality, feminity (although it is true that boy babies often wear it,) fidelity, cleanness and freshness. There is very little negative aspect associated with this colour!</p>
<p><em>PINK:</em> This is a &quot;new&quot; colour, invented in the 17th Century to describe the colour of the flowers called pinks. We think of it as a feminine, sweet colour, but in Japan, adult movies are called &quot;pink&quot; movies. In Catholicism is symbolizes joy and happiness.</p>
<p><em>YELLOW:</em> Shine, light, knowledge, happiness, and joy. On the other side, it suggests deceit and cowardice. In Egypt it is traditionally associated with mourning, in Japan, courage. The Chinese connect it to the Yang principle of Yin-Yang&#8211;the active, creative male side.</p>
<p><em>ORANGE:</em> It is reported that people who love life like orange. It is stimulating but warm. It adds verve to earth tones and, when used with white, reminds people of those childhood treats, vanilla ice-cream wrapped in orange Popsicle.</p>
<p><em>BROWN:</em> Could be dull, but it is considered natural, down-to-earth, friendly, dependable. A neutral you can mix with many other colours to warm your celebration.</p>
<p>So consider your wedding image: Vibrant? Responsible? Warm? Gentle? Compassionate? A forever, steady relationship? Think about what your colours are saying!</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><strong>Author: Bonnie Ray</strong>  It&#8217;s not your mother&#8217;s wedding, so stop worrying about doing everything her way. This is a time for you to express your individual taste and style. So what if she never would have dreamed of carrying &quot;fake&quot; flowers in her bridal bouquet. In her generation fake flowers were plastic. Of course she wouldn&#8217;t have used them!  </p>
<p>This is a new generation and silk wedding flowers are the rage! Not only have &quot;fake&quot; flowers evolved in leaps and bounds, but they have also become very popular as alternatives to fresh flowers for wedding bouquets, flower girl baskets, corsages and boutonnieres. From the exquisite cascading bridal bouquet to the simplistic hand-tied wedding bouquet, silk wedding flowers lend themselves to every style imaginable!</p>
<p>Elegant silk calla lilies look lovely, whether cascading downward intermingled with ivy, or when in a hand-tied bridal bouquet. Silk roses in a rainbow of colors combine nicely with a variety of other flowers in a clutch bridal bouquet or in a cascading wedding bouquet. </p>
<p>The look is so close to that of fresh flowers that most people will never even know the difference. But your checkbook will!  Purchasing silk wedding flower packages is what many smart brides are doing. Eliminating the stress of last-minute florist mix-ups, ordering your silk wedding flower sets from one of the online merchants is convenient and cost-effective. </p>
<p>With packages starting under $300, silks have made wedding flowers affordable.  Beware of low-quality silks, however. Make sure that you&#8217;re getting top-of-the-line silk flowers if you want to fool everyone that they&#8217;re real. Quality silk wedding flowers are so realistic that people will want to smell your bridal bouquet! To fool them, try spritzing your wedding bouquets with rose oil or another floral fragrance. </p>
<p>Flower girl baskets can carry a stationary arrangement or an assortment of silk rose petals to be scattered down the aisle for the bride to walk upon. Walking on rose petals is symbolic of both beauty and of the bride walking down the path of a new life that is about to begin. Another alternative for the flower girl is for her to carry a silk floral pomander. The flowers can match those in the bridal bouquet and your little flower girl will look adorable swinging her beautiful pomander to and fro as she heads down the aisle. This is especially conducive to very young flower girls.  </p>
<p>The ring bearer&#8217;s pillow has an alternative as well. A fabric covered ring box can be carried down the aisle by your young attendant. This is a more contemporary look for the ring bearer, who often balks at carrying a lacy pillow.  </p>
<p>In lieu of traditional corsages, consider giving the special women at the wedding small hand-tied bouquets for them to carry. With today&#8217;s flimsier fabrics, pin on corsages are sometimes too bulky to wear. However, by using silk flowers, the weight of the corsages is dramatically decreased. Maybe you could point that out as a benefit to your mother as you gently remind her &#8212; this isn&#8217;t her wedding after all.<p>Technorati Tags: <a href="http://technorati.com/tag/Wedding+Flowers" rel="tag">Wedding Flowers</a>, <a href="http://technorati.com/tag/Silk+Wedding+Flowers" rel="tag"> Silk Wedding Flowers</a></p>

<p>Jewelry materials like what is used in wedding rings have evolved over the years. Popular is the 14K/18 yellow gold which you will find more of a favourable option worldwide. Close on its heels is the white gold gaining more popularity by the day.  Why not consider platinum, known to be one of the hardest metals and once again a fine choice in a wedding ring.</p>
<p>Platinum is a durable material and therefore able to hold up to any wear and tear. Platinum wedding rings look very similar to rings made of white gold which many can be excused for the mix up but at the end of the day both look stylish and elegant. However, platinum wedding rings are more expensive.</p>
<p>For the man it has to be Titanium which is becoming a favourite among the male species. It is light and long lasting and far less expensive as platinum. Once again Titanium wedding rings can be mistaken for the white gold in appearance.</p>
